Gabriel de Tarde (1843–1904) was an eminent French sociologist and criminologist who wrote Underground Man (Fragment d’histoire future, 1896), imagining humanity driven beneath the surface after the Sun cools, and there building a refined aesthetic civilisation. A thoughtful, elegant contribution to far-future and catastrophe fiction from a major social theorist.
